  • For snacks, I like Fiber One bars, 100 calorie packs of popcorn, Tricuits or carrots and hummus, carrots and Trader joes black bean dip, fruit and vegetables

    For meals, the e-mails have really good recipe ideas as do the WW cookbooks.  Off the top of my head, some good ones are Tex Mex Rice and Bean Casserole, Baked Macaroni and Cheese, Broccoli Cheese Soup, Cheese Enchiladas, Shrimp Mojo 

    The Hungry Girl blog has really good recipes for snacks, drinks, etc.  I saw she has a cookbook out yet that I want to buy but haven't done it yet.

     I lost all 27 lbs while BFing and it took about 6 months.

  • I can't help with food ideas.  I just ate what I normally ate and watched the portions.  I was on the nursing moms program for WW and the weight came off SLOW, but it came off.  From my highest weight at 39w pg, I had 60 lbs. to lose (obviously, 8lbs. was baby, plus water weight, etc. so it was really less) but it was gone at 5m PP.  The key is to just stick with it and not get discouraged by the gradual weight loss.  I even gained some weeks, but it did come off over time.
